« Reply #5 on: May 30, 2010, 04:08:15 PM »

Well done Yvan,
Very,very strong headwind,cold and rain.
1/2 finals:Jonn- Justin
              Mikko-Andreas ( most exciting match of the day ).
Finals:     Mikko-John,  winner MIKKO.
Longest drive : Kari 291 m.
Distances are not representative due to the weather conditions, but 291 m is impressive.

I forgot to give Saturday results...

CJ - 308 m
Kari - 305 m
Niklas - 300 m

112 persons tried to qualify and the first 3 were :
Romain BECHU (Alps Tour player) - 292 m (but ruined his back and had to withdraw Cheesy Cheesy Cheesy Cheesy)
Edouard PENIN (Alps Tour player) - 276 m who ended in quarters
Xavier Richaud (Amateur) - 262 m

A bit less wind with only 30 km/h head wind... Cheesy Cheesy Cheesy Cheesy Cheesy
